    This week’s parable of the wise and foolish virgins illustrates far more than appears at a first reading. The Christian Science Spiritual Interpretation of this parable by Stamp and Moss brings out the higher lessons in this parable. As the article says of the foolish virgins, “If they succumb to the suggestion that they must go away and consecrate their life to the spiritual for a period of time until their lamps are filled with the oil of gladness and inspiration, then they miss the boat. The remedy therefore does not lie in believing that they are the source of the light and inspiration and that their negligence can consequently affect the issue. They have it in their power to correct that suggestion and to realize that Mind is always present and always expressing itself through them without any need of premeditated reasoning….”if those called the foolish virgins became aware enough to see where wisdom originates and to admit that they were the expression of wisdom, then they would have a more real encounter with the joy of accomplishment symbolized by the bridegroom.” To read the complete article about this parable click on this link: https://mbeinstitute.org/ap/author/stamp-maas/parables/auth-stamp-maas-parable-19-matt-25-v01-the-wise-and-foolish-virgins-vol-11-2.pdf
